Introduction

The Bently Nevada 330103-00-06-05-12-05 3300 XL 8mm Proximity Probe is a high-performance eddy current displacement sensor designed for continuous monitoring of shaft vibration, axial position, and radial movement in rotating machinery. As part of the widely adopted 3300 XL transducer system, it delivers highly stable and repeatable measurements even under severe industrial conditions such as high vibration, temperature fluctuation, and mechanical stress.

This configuration is commonly used in predictive maintenance systems where long-term reliability and measurement consistency are critical for protecting turbines, compressors, pumps, and other essential rotating equipment.


Technical Specifications

CategorySpecification
Product Series3300 XL
Model Number330103-00-06-05-12-05
Probe Type8 mm Eddy Current Proximity Probe
Measurement PrincipleNon-contact electromagnetic induction
System Compatibility3300 XL Proximitor Sensor System
Linear Range~0.25 mm to 2.3 mm
Output SignalVoltage proportional to gap distance
Frequency ResponseDC to ~10 kHz
Operating Temperature-52°C to +177°C
Case MaterialStainless steel (industrial grade)
Probe Tip MaterialPPS (Polyphenylene sulfide)
Connector TypeMiniature ClickLoc™ coaxial
Cable TypeShielded coaxial (FluidLoc compatible)
Case Length~60 mm (typical configuration for “06”)
Cable Length~0.5 m (configuration “05”)
Weight~0.30–0.32 kg

Technical FAQs

1. What does this probe measure?
It measures shaft vibration, displacement, and axial position using eddy current sensing.

2. Is it a contact or non-contact device?
It is a non-contact proximity probe.

3. What system is it designed for?
It is designed for the Bently Nevada 3300 XL Proximitor system.

4. What does the “06-05” configuration indicate?
It typically refers to housing length (~60 mm) and cable length (~0.5 m).

5. What industries use this probe?
Power generation, oil & gas, petrochemical, and heavy industry.

6. Can it operate in high temperatures?
Yes, it supports up to approximately 177°C in industrial environments.

7. What material is it made from?
Stainless steel housing with PPS probe tip.

8. Does it require physical contact with the shaft?
No, it operates via electromagnetic field coupling.

9. How is it installed?
Threaded mounting with ClickLoc coaxial connector system.

10. What is its expected service life?
Long-term industrial use with minimal maintenance under proper installation.
